"An aid to identifying African American artists and locating reproductions of their work that have been published in books, magazines, and exhibition catalogs, ranging in time from the colonial period to the present. The photographic reproductions indexed have appeared in publications published in the US through the end of 1990, and all are or have been generally available. Alphabetically arranged by artist, entries include personal information, identified published reproductions, type of art, date, museum holding, and place of publication.
